Foundation Support Service is a critical aspect of maintaining the structural integrity of any building. It involves the assessment, repair, and reinforcement of a building's foundation to ensure it remains stable and secure. Over time, foundations can experience issues such as settling, cracking, or shifting due to various factors like soil erosion, moisture levels, or the natural settling of the ground. Addressing these issues promptly through professional Foundation Support Service can prevent more significant structural problems in the future. Ensuring a strong foundation is essential for the safety and longevity of a building, as it directly impacts the overall stability and value of the property. By investing in proper foundation support, property owners can protect their investment and avoid costly repairs down the line.
